the cellars-hohenortThe 5-star Cellars-Hohenort hotel is situated in an area known as ‘Cape Town’s Vineyard’ – the historical Constantia Valley, a short 15-minute drive from Cape Town’s city centre. With luxurious rooms with breath-taking views, a wellness spa and two award-winning restaurants, Greenhouse and The Conservatory, The Cellars-Hohenhort is a wonderful place to spend the day, or even the weekend.

Heritage Day High Tea

During this special long weekend, the legendary Cellars-Hohenort High Tea will pay homage to our cultural wealth as a nation, with a special nod to South African heritage via a culinary journey that spans all the corners of our beautiful country.

Ideal as a family gathering or celebration among friends, Heritage High Tea will be served in The Conservatory restaurant, overlooking the magnificent garden surrounds. The gourmet goodness, priced at R315 per head, includes tea and coffee, and a sumptuous sweet and savoury tower of delights. From High Tea classics like mini scones with strawberry jam and Chantilly cream, to traditional Koeksisters, Bhanji chilli bites, Bobotie spring rolls and Cape Malay mini-vetkoek – all the SA favourites are considered in a smorgasbord of flavours.
